Computers in schools: money well-spent, Concordia University study says - 2 views

  • Where technology does have a positive impact is when it actively engages students, when it's used as a communication tool, when it's used for things like simulations or games that enable students to actively manipulate the environment."
    • Vicki Treadway
       
      Exactly!
    • anonymous
       
      Then this would seem to support the use of ipads, since that's basically what you do when you "work with" apps.
  • Grumberg said she can't see how the school can meet the needs of today's children if it doesn't teach them in the way they need to learn - "and the way they learn is through the manipulation of these technologies."
